php添加分类怎么写

worktile 其他 134

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    添加分类的方法:

    在PHP中,可以使用`array_push()`函数将一个或多个元素添加到数组末尾,或者可以直接使用数组下标来给数组赋值来添加元素。

    1. 使用`array_push()`函数添加元素:

    “`php
    $array = []; // 创建一个空数组

    // 使用array_push()函数添加元素
    array_push($array, “元素1”, “元素2”, “元素3”);

    print_r($array);
    “`

    输出:

    “`
    Array
    (
    [0] => 元素1
    [1] => 元素2
    [2] => 元素3
    )
    “`

    2. 使用数组下标添加元素:

    “`php
    $array = []; // 创建一个空数组

    // 使用数组下标给数组赋值添加元素
    $array[0] = “元素1”;
    $array[1] = “元素2”;
    $array[2] = “元素3”;

    print_r($array);
    “`

    输出:

    “`
    Array
    (
    [0] => 元素1
    [1] => 元素2
    [2] => 元素3
    )
    “`

    以上是在原有数组末尾添加元素的方法。如果想要在指定位置添加元素,可以使用`array_splice()`函数。

    “`php
    $array = [“元素1”, “元素2”, “元素3”];

    // 在数组的第二个位置添加元素
    array_splice($array, 1, 0, “插入的元素”);

    print_r($array);
    “`

    输出:

    “`
    Array
    (
    [0] => 元素1
    [1] => 插入的元素
    [2] => 元素2
    [3] => 元素3
    )
    “`

    通过使用`array_push()`函数、数组下标或`array_splice()`函数,可以在PHP中轻松添加元素到数组中。根据实际需求选择适合的方法即可。记得在使用这些方法前,首先要创建一个空数组或者已经存在的数组。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中添加分类可以通过以下步骤来完成:

    1. 创建分类表:首先,需要创建一个新的数据库表来存储分类的信息。可以使用MySQL或其他数据库管理系统来创建这个表。表中应该包含分类的唯一标识符(ID)、名称、描述等字段。

    2. 编写数据库连接代码:接下来,在PHP中编写数据库连接代码,以便能够连接到数据库并执行相关操作。可以使用PDO(PHP Data Objects)或mysqli等扩展来连接数据库。

    3. 添加分类页面:创建一个用于添加分类的页面,可以使用HTML和CSS来设计界面。页面上应该包含一个表单,其中包括输入分类名称、描述等字段的表单元素,并提供一个提交按钮。

    4. 处理分类添加请求:在PHP中编写代码来处理从添加分类页面提交的请求。可以使用POST方法来获取表单中的数据,并将这些数据插入到数据库的分类表中。

    5. 显示分类列表:创建一个页面来显示分类列表,可以使用HTML和CSS来渲染页面。通过PHP的数据库查询功能,从分类表中查询数据,并将其显示在页面上。

    6. 可选:添加编辑和删除功能:如果需要允许用户编辑和删除分类,可以在分类列表页面上添加相应的按钮,并编写相应的代码来处理这些请求。可以使用SQL语句来更新或删除分类表中的数据。

    以上就是在PHP中添加分类的基本步骤。当然,具体的实现方式可能会根据具体项目的需求而有所不同。此外,安全性也是一个重要的考虑因素,需要对用户提交的数据进行适当的验证和过滤,以防止SQL注入等安全风险。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中添加分类的方法和操作流程如下:

    第一步:创建分类表
    首先,我们需要创建一个用于存储分类信息的数据表。可以使用MySQL等数据库管理系统来创建表。表中需要包含以下字段:分类编号(category_id)、分类名称(category_name)、父分类编号(parent_id)等。这些字段可以根据实际需求进行调整。

    第二步:定义分类类
    在PHP中,我们可以使用类来表示分类。在定义分类类时,我们需要定义一些属性和方法来实现分类的功能。这些属性和方法可以根据实际需求进行调整。一个简单的分类类的定义如下:

    “`
    class Category {
    private $categoryId;
    private $categoryName;
    private $parentId;

    public function __construct($categoryId, $categoryName, $parentId) {
    $this->categoryId = $categoryId;
    $this->categoryName = $categoryName;
    $this->parentId = $parentId;
    }

    // 添加其他需要的方法
    }
    “`

    第三步:添加分类
    在PHP中,我们可以通过表单提交或者其他方式来获取用户输入的分类信息。一般来说,用户输入的分类名称和父分类编号会作为参数传递给添加分类的方法。添加分类的方法可以根据实际需求进行调整。一个简单的添加分类的方法如下:

    “`
    function addCategory($categoryName, $parentId) {
    // 创建数据库连接并插入分类数据
    $conn = new mysqli(‘localhost’, ‘username’, ‘password’, ‘database_name’);
    $sql = “INSERT INTO categories(category_name, parent_id) VALUES (‘$categoryName’, ‘$parentId’)”;
    $result = $conn->query($sql);

    // 关闭数据库连接
    $conn->close();

    if ($result === TRUE) {
    echo “分类添加成功”;
    } else {
    echo “分类添加失败”;
    }
    }
    “`

    第四步:调用添加分类方法
    在需要添加分类的地方,我们可以调用上述的添加分类方法,传递用户输入的分类名称和父分类编号作为参数。一个简单的调用添加分类方法的示例代码如下:

    “`
    $categoryName = $_POST[‘category_name’];
    $parentId = $_POST[‘parent_id’];
    addCategory($categoryName, $parentId);
    “`

    通过上述的步骤,我们可以在PHP中实现添加分类的功能。在实际应用中,还可以进一步完善分类的功能,如编辑分类、删除分类等。同时,为了展示更好的用户体验,可以添加表单验证、输入过滤等操作来提高分类的安全性。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部